Transaction 43564c116602f33ebabc1f2255c8d77e6085df9fd03d6482f4b1d42a9851e61a

1 Input
2 Outputs
  • 43564c116602f33ebabc1f2255c8d77e6085df9fd03d6482f4b1d42a9851e61a:0
  • value  6552064
    address  37Z2KZcubFQFuVrCSCYFUtXXsyBhkvYmLu
  • 43564c116602f33ebabc1f2255c8d77e6085df9fd03d6482f4b1d42a9851e61a:1
  • value  63785021
    address  1KkEQgEi1TvTHWoKxHDFojk2KAceXZZ8bA